Allon Hochbaum

Allon Hochbaum is a Samueli Early Career Assistant Professor in the Department of Chemical Engineering and Materials Science and the Department of Chemistry at the University of California, Irvine. He received a S.B. in Materials Science and Engineering from the Massachusetts Institute of Technology and completed his Ph.D. in the Department of Chemistry at UC Berkeley studying electrical and thermal transport phenomena in semiconductor nanowires. He was a postdoctoral research fellow at Harvard University where his research explored bacterial community dynamics at interfaces.

Prof. Hochbaum is the recipient of the 3M Non-Tenured Faculty award, and the ACS (Division of Inorganic Chemistry) and AFOSR Young Investigator awards. His lab studies and designs electronically conductive natural and synthetic biomaterials, and seeks to understand and engineer chemical signaling pathways involved in bacterial community development and antibiotic tolerance using chemical and physical approaches.
